Historic Advancement of Glaucoma Treatments



The historical advancement of glaucoma therapies dates back to old worlds where various remedies were utilized to take care of the condition. In old Egypt, for example, therapies entailed a mixture of honey, fat, and sour milk put on the eyes. The Greeks and Romans additionally contributed to very early glaucoma treatments with a concentrate on topical applications and dietary treatments. Throughout history, diverse societies developed special techniques to minimize the symptoms of glaucoma, commonly rooted in natural solutions and superstitious notions.

As time progressed, advancements in medical understanding caused even more organized methods to treating glaucoma. Between Ages, Arabic scholars made significant payments by examining the composition of the eye and establishing medical methods to address eye problems. These early technologies laid the foundation for modern glaucoma therapies that we've today. Comprehending the historical context of glaucoma treatments offers useful understandings right into the continuous progression and refinement of medical practices over the centuries.

Contrast of Traditional Methods



In comparing typical methods for dealing with glaucoma, think about the historical contexts and effectiveness of different treatments.

Standard treatments for glaucoma have evolved over centuries, from old methods like using honey and red wine to much more recent innovations such as eye declines and surgical procedures. Historically, solutions like the application of leeches or natural mixtures were used to ease signs and symptoms, however their effectiveness was restricted.

As time proceeded, methods like iridectomy, where a part of the iris is removed, ended up being popular for lowering intraocular pressure. Some standard approaches, like utilizing oral medications to reduce eye pressure, have stood the test of time and are still used today. Nonetheless, these therapies typically include negative effects and may not be as reliable as modern alternatives.

It's vital to weigh the historic significance of typical glaucoma treatments against their effectiveness in the context of current clinical innovations.

Furthermore, the advancement of sustained-release medication shipment systems has provided a much more efficient way to carry out glaucoma medication. These systems can release medicine progressively over an extended period, enhancing individual adherence and reducing the frequency of eye declines.

Moreover, emerging modern technologies like careful laser trabeculoplasty (SLT) use a non-invasive option for reducing intraocular pressure by targeting particular cells in the eye's drainage system.
